Finiteness
The state or quality of having limitations or bounds; recognizing the limits of one's life, resources, or abilities.
Raise Consciousness
To enhance one's awareness or understanding about social, political, or personal issues, often leading to a collective shift in perspective or action.
Egoentric Experience
A perspective where an individual interprets the world solely from their own viewpoint, often neglecting the perspectives of others.
Objectified Others
The perception of other people as objects or instruments for one's own purposes, rather than as individuals with their own autonomy.
